For nearly 25 years, MyGlobalClassroom has provided free educational distance-learning materials, in 22 languages, to underserved K-12 students worldwide. Now, with new government funding, we are launching an ambitious and groundbreaking storytelling initiative unlike anything currently being offered to emerging screenwriters.

Introducing the MyGlobalClassroom Storytelling Fellowship -- a paid opportunity for 60 talented writers to create a new generation of short-form films for young audiences that entertain first while quietly exploring the social realities kids face every day.

These are not lectures. They are not PSAs. And they are definitely not “very special episodes.”

Inspired by the groundbreaking work of TV pioneer Norman Lear, whose legendary series such as “All in the Family” used humor, conflict, and emotionally honest characters to tackle difficult social issues, this initiative seeks writers capable of blending comedy and drama into stories that feel authentic, surprising, funny, moving, and deeply human.

Our films will explore themes such as:

• belonging
• exclusion
• identity
• online cruelty
• friendship
• loneliness
• misunderstanding
• empathy
• social pressure
• racism
• bullying
• disability inclusion
• class differences
• family struggles
• emotional resilience

...but always through compelling storytelling rather than overt messaging.

We are looking for writers who understand that young audiences do not want to be lectured. They want to laugh, feel recognized, become emotionally invested, and see themselves reflected honestly onscreen.

Selected fellows will be commissioned to write one original 10–20 minute screenplay and will receive:

• $5,000 compensation per script
• 50% payment upfront
• 50% upon delivery
• produced screen credit
• the opportunity to contribute to a worldwide educational media initiative reaching students across the globe.

This is not a screenplay competition. It is a paid writing fellowship designed to discover bold, emotionally truthful voices capable of creating socially conscious entertainment for today’s generation.

Writers may submit an existing screenplay, pilot, stage play, short film, or other writing sample demonstrating strong character work, dialogue, humor, emotional authenticity, and storytelling ability.

Examples of the kinds of stories we hope to produce include:

• A harmless group chat joke spirals into a devastating online pile-on when nobody wants to be the first person to say, “This isn’t funny anymore.”
• A popular student accidentally becomes the target of the very rumor culture she helped create.
• A shy girl secretly runs every successful school event while louder students take all the credit.
• Two students from completely different social groups reluctantly team up for a talent show and slowly realize they’ve both been pretending to be someone else.
• A bilingual student grows exhausted from acting as the adult translator for his immigrant parents everywhere they go.
• A disabled gamer joins the school esports team only to discover his teammates want his talent but not his visibility.

The goal is simple:

Create stories young people genuinely want to watch -- stories that entertain, connect, provoke conversation, and perhaps help audiences see one another a little differently by the time the credits roll.

Eligibility:

Open to writers age 18 and older from any country.
Writers of all backgrounds and experience levels are encouraged to apply.
Previous professional screenwriting credits are welcome but not required.
Applicants may submit individually only. Collaborative writing teams are not eligible at this time unless approved in advance by MyGlobalClassroom.

Submission Materials:

Applicants may submit one writing sample in any of the following formats:

Feature screenplay
Short screenplay
Television pilot
Stage play
Produced short film script
Excerpt from a longer dramatic or comedic work

Submitted work should demonstrate:

Strong character development
Dialogue
Emotional authenticity
Humor and/or dramatic storytelling ability
A unique voice

Work does not need to address educational or social themes directly.

Submission Limits:
Limit one submission per writer. Multiple submissions from the same applicant may be disqualified or reviewed at the discretion of MyGlobalClassroom.

Language & Format Requirements:

Submissions must be written in English. All submissions must be uploaded as a PDF file through FilmFreeway. Please ensure all PDF files are readable and properly formatted before submitting.

Original Work:

All submitted material must be the applicant’s original work. By submitting, the applicant confirms they hold all rights to the material and have authority to submit it for review. Adaptations are acceptable only if the applicant controls or has secured the underlying rights.

Use of Artificial Intelligence:

MyGlobalClassroom is seeking work driven by the applicant’s original voice, perspective, and storytelling ability. AI may be used for minor proofreading or formatting support only. Howeve, AI-generated scripts are not eligible. Submissions must reflect the applicant’s own original writing, character development, dialogue, and creative expression. By submitting, applicants affirm that the submitted material substantially represents their own original authorship.

Selection Process:

Applications will be reviewed by the MyGlobalClassroom selection committee.

Selected fellows will be chosen based on:

Strength of writing
Original voice
Character and dialogue
Emotional truth
Ability to balance entertainment with meaningful human storytelling
Potential fit for MyGlobalClassroom’s short-form educational film initiative
